Valentine’s day cocktails – Pornstar Martini

This tasty little number is so delicious it will blow your socks off. Bursting with passion (fruit), it’s the perfect way to create a bar vibe – in your lounge, bathroom or bedroom
Ingredients
- X1 Handful of The Ice Co’s Premium Ice Cubes
- X2 Measures of Vodka
- X 1 & 1/2 Measures of Passoa
- X 1/2 Measure of Sugar Syrup
- X 1/2 Measure of Lime Juice
- X 1 Measure of Prosecco
- Garnish – Passion Fruit Half
1. Add the ice and all the other ingredients to a cocktail shaker.
2. Shake hard and strain into a martini glass.
3. Place a passionfruit half on top and it’s ready to serve!
Valentine’s day cocktails – Pink Pineapple Passion

Ramp up the passion with this pineapple and gin-based cocktail, Pink Pineapple Passion. Oozing with tropical flavours, it’s guaranteed to leave you feeling fruity and wanting more.
Ingredients
- X 2 Handfuls of The Ice Co’s Premium Ice Cube
- X 1 & 1/2 Measures of Gin
- X 4 Measures of Pineapple Juice
- X 1 Measure of Campari Bitters
- X 1/2 Measure of Lime Juice
- Garnish – Pineapple Wedge
- Garnish – Orange Peel
Method
- Add one handful of ice and all the other ingredients to a cocktail shaker,
- Shake for 30 seconds and strain into a tall glass of the remaining large ice cubes.
- Garnish with a pineapple chunk, orange peel and serve!
Valentine’s day cocktails – Raspberry Martini Fizz

This stylish cocktail, Raspberry Martini Fizz, will excite your tastebuds and is guaranteed to keep your other half sweet all night long.
Ingredients
- X 1 Handful of The Ice Co’s Premium Ice Cubes
- X 1 Measure of Martini Rosso
- X 1 Measure of Gin
- X 1/2 Teaspoon of Icing Sugar
- X 1 Handful of Raspberries
- Top Up – Prosecco
Method
- Add the ice, Martini Rosso and gin to a cocktail shaker and shake for 30 seconds.
- Ad d the icing sugar to a glass and strain in the martini mix.
- Top with Prosecco, add the raspberries and serve.
